Subject: Quickstore 4.2 — bloom filter now fronts the KV layer

Plugin authors: starting with this release, Quickstore places a bloom filter ahead of the key-value store. Negative lookups return faster; false positives fall through safely. No API changes are required on your side. Verify your plugin against the staging build referenced below.

session token of fahif-tadup = htk3_9c7

Acquisition Watch — Managers Only

Tarlow Instruments is evaluating a purchase of Brightmere Optics. Diligence is underway; no outreach to Brightmere staff or customers. Sales leads: keep pipeline forecasts separate from any assumed Brightmere volume. Pricing on the Veyla line stays unchanged until close. Questions go to the deal desk only. Do not circulate this page. The confidential business note is appended directly below.

internal memo for yajef-tajeg: The renewal with Ralaelek Group closes at $2 million a year, 15 percent above the last contract. Project Zorix slips by two quarters because of the tooling delay.

## Further Reading

The Kestrelmatch driver-assignment heuristic weighs proximity, shift fatigue, and vehicle class before scoring candidates. It intentionally avoids global optimization to keep assignment latency under 50ms; we accept roughly 4% suboptimal matches as a tradeoff. For the weekly sync, please skim the scoring weights and the fallback path used when no driver scores above threshold. The complete heuristic writeup lives on the internal design page.

runbook for hawif-tajeg: https://grafana.plorvasoft.example/dash

### Step 4: Repoint the Crash Ingest Worker

The Lanternjaw mobile apps now ship crash reports through the new Faultline pipeline instead of the legacy collector. Symbolication happens downstream, so the worker only needs ingest and queue credentials. Drain the legacy queue first; any reports left after the cutover window are dropped, not replayed. Expect a brief spike in retry noise for about ten minutes after restart — that's normal. Once the drain completes, restart the worker with the following configuration.

deployment values, fahap-hahaf:
[casdor]
port = 9200
region = south-2
host = casdor.qirvanworks.corp
timeout_ms = 3000
retries = 4